President of Azerbaijan Ilham Aliyev has approved the United Nations Convention against Cybercrime.
According to Report, the President signed the law approving the United Nations Convention against Cybercrime; Strengthening International Cooperation for Combating Certain Crimes Committed by Means of Information and Communications Technology Systems and for the Sharing of Evidence in Electronic Form of Serious Crimes.
